Wine Cap
Stropharia rugosoannulata
Also called king stropharia, garden giant, burgundy mushroom, wine cap stropharia
A large mulch-bed mushroom with a wine-red cap fading to tan, purple-grey gills, and an unmistakable thick white ring whose upper surface splits into radiating cogwheel spokes.
Overview
Stropharia rugosoannulata is the giant of its genus, capable of producing caps thirty centimetres across in a rich wood-chip bed. It is a fungus of made ground rather than wild woodland, and it has spread widely through gardens, parks, and landscaped areas wherever bark and wood chip mulch is used, often arriving with the mulch itself.
The genus Stropharia belongs to the family Strophariaceae and is defined by attached gills, dark purple-brown to purple-black spore prints, and a well-developed membranous ring. What makes this species instantly recognisable is the structure of that ring: the epithet rugosoannulata means wrinkled-ringed, and the thick upper surface of the ring is grooved into radiating ribs that break into pointed segments, producing a shape usually described as a cogwheel or star.
Colour is variable and can mislead. Young caps in cool damp conditions are a deep wine red or burgundy, but sun and age bleach them through reddish tan to buff, dull ochre, and finally a washed-out greyish straw, so a single bed can show several apparently different mushrooms at once.
How to identify it
Cap
The cap is 5-20 cm across and sometimes far larger, hemispherical and tightly domed when young with the margin curled under, then convex and finally broadly flattened, occasionally with a shallow central depression in age. The surface is dry and smooth, sometimes finely cracked in dry weather, and the margin often retains white triangular fragments of the partial veil. Colour runs from deep wine red or reddish purple-brown when young through reddish tan to buff, straw, or greyish ochre as it weathers.
Gills
The gills are adnate, crowded, and moderately broad. They start pale whitish grey, pass through a distinctive pale lilac or violet-grey stage, and finish dark purple-brown to almost blackish purple as the spores mature. Gill edges are often finely white-fringed and paler than the faces.
Stipe
The stipe is 8-15 cm long and 1-3 cm thick, stout, solid, white to cream, and smooth above the ring with a slightly scurfy or scaly texture below in some collections. It is usually somewhat swollen or club-shaped at the base, from which thick white mycelial cords, or rhizomorphs, radiate into the substrate. The ring is the diagnostic feature: thick, membranous, positioned high on the stem, and grooved on its upper surface into radiating ribs that split into star-like points, frequently stained dark by fallen spores.
Flesh and spore print
The flesh is thick, firm, and white, showing little or no colour change when cut, with a mild earthy odour. The spore print is dark purple-brown to purple-black.
Where and when it grows
This is a species of rich, disturbed, woody or strawy substrates rather than undisturbed forest soil. It fruits abundantly in hardwood chip and bark mulch on garden beds, path edges, playgrounds, and municipal landscaping, and also on straw, sawdust, composted plant waste, and heavily enriched garden soil. Fruiting typically begins a few months after fresh mulch is laid and can continue for two or three seasons until the substrate is exhausted.
The season is long, running from late spring through summer and into autumn, with flushes following heavy rain and warm weather. It is native to temperate Europe, Asia, and North America and is now effectively cosmopolitan in temperate regions, its distribution greatly extended by the international trade in mulch and by deliberate establishment in wood-chip beds.
Ecological role
Stropharia rugosoannulata is a saprotroph and an aggressive coloniser of coarse woody debris. Its mycelium forms conspicuous thick white cords that run through chip and straw beds, and it breaks down lignin and cellulose in a white-rot process, converting rough mulch into dark crumbly humus. It competes strongly with other decomposers and can dominate a fresh bed within a single season.
The fungus is unusual in preying on nematodes. Its mycelium produces specialised acanthocyte cells, spiny star-shaped structures that immobilise and puncture soil nematodes, allowing the fungus to draw nitrogen from them and supplement what is a nitrogen-poor wood diet. These acanthocytes are also a definitive microscopic character for the genus. Ecologically the species is an important recycler in landscaped ground, improving soil structure and speeding the turnover of woody waste.
Similar species
Other Stropharia species share the purple-brown spore print and ring, but none has the cogwheel ring. Stropharia hornemannii is a conifer-wood species with a distinctly viscid, glutinous cap in purplish brown, and a smooth ring. Stropharia aeruginosa is small and unmistakably blue-green with a slimy cap. Stropharia coronilla is much smaller, yellow-buff, and grows in grassland, with a smooth ring.
Large Agaricus species can approach it in size and stature but have gills completely free of the stem that pass through a clear pink stage to chocolate brown, and give a dark brown rather than purple-black spore print; their rings are smooth or split into a cogwheel on the underside rather than grooved on top. Agrocybe species growing in the same mulch beds are smaller and drop dull tobacco-brown spores. Hypholoma species also give purple-brown prints but are much smaller, cluster tightly on wood, and leave only a cobwebby ring zone rather than a thick membranous ring.
